Carolyn Brodie, MS, NCC, is a National Certified Counselor who works with women and LGBTQIA+ clients aged 16 and above. She has a specialized focus on Eating Disorders (including Anorexia, Bulimia, ARFID, OSFED, and Binge Eating Disorder) and Anxiety diagnoses.
Her therapeutic style is rooted in person-centered talk therapy and draws from Cognitive Behavioral Therapy (CBT), CBT-E, Dialectical Behavior Therapy (DBT), and Acceptance and Commitment Therapy (ACT). She offers both in-person and virtual therapy sessions to provide flexible care.
As a member of The Association for Size Diversity and Health (ASDAH), Carolyn’s practice is informed by the principles of Health at Every Size and body neutrality. She supports clients in challenging diet culture and Euro-centric metrics of health, developing boundaries, and validating and empowering them to define health on their own terms.
